Old Faithful Visitor Education Center — Old Faithful Visitor Education Center

The Old Faithful Visitor Education Center in Yellowstone National Park, Wyoming, opened August 25, 2010, replacing a 1970s-era facility; BBI Engineering installed the center's AV systems, including an earthquake monitor, interactive map kiosks, and a surround-sound theater, as part of a decade-long AV relationship with the National Park Service spanning Yellowstone's Canyon, Old Faithful, and Mammoth visitor centers.
